The Ying and Yang of Sisterhood

When I was beaten down at a new low she lifted me up from the depths below. When I fell quite ill she was always there with a helping hand, giving love and care. Tho each different, our moods would collide, but down deep, our love we could never hide. When from time to time we would live apart we always kept each other in our heart. And now we live together once again, in our old age, let the patience begin. We’ve learned to let humor temper it all with a kind word if the other might fall. Sisters made stronger, as if we were one from our first breath, the connection begun.
